#b8be0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b8be0c is composed of 72.2% red, 74.5%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 62 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 39.6%. #b8be0c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#717d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#b8be0c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b8be0c has RGB values of R:184, G:190,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12107276.

Shades and Tints of #b8be0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050500 is the darkest color, while #fefef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b8be0c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686961 is the less saturated color, while #bfc604 is the most saturated one.
